#58e2dd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#58e2dd is composed of 34.5% red, 88.6% green and 86.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 2.2%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 177.8 degrees, a saturation of 70.4% and a lightness of 61.6%. #58e2dd color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ffff with #00c5bb.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#58e2dd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#eefcfc is the lightest one.
